## Formula sandbox tuning

User-supplied formulas in Gridmoor execute inside a restricted interpreter with hard ceilings on time, memory, and call depth. Reviewers should confirm any change to these ceilings is justified in the PR description, since raising them widens the abuse surface. Defaults were chosen from production traces. The current limits are as follows.

limits module of tafog-fawip:
WEIGHTS = {
    "julix": 57,
    "lamys": 992,
    "kasvan": 209,
    "quenok": 750,
    "alddor": 259,
    "oliath": 1009,
    "wenix": 815,
}

### Runbook: Report export timezone mismatches (Glimmerfield)

If a customer reports that exported totals differ from the dashboard, check whether their report schedule predates the March cutover — older schedules still render in server-local time rather than the account timezone. Re-saving the schedule fixes it. Before escalating, confirm the export worker is running with the expected timezone settings shown below.

config for kadup-kajog:
[raldor]
host = raldor.tolvaqworks.internal
user = raldor_svc
database = raldor_prod

MEMO — Tessler & Vane, Internal Only

To: Branch Managers
Re: Hiring Freeze, Fieldworks Division

Effective immediately, all recruitment within the Fieldworks Division is paused, including backfills and contractor extensions. Offers already signed will be honoured. Internal transfers require divisional sign-off. This measure follows the mid-year review and is expected to last one quarter, subject to reassessment. Please route any exception requests through your regional lead. The underlying business rationale is set out in the note below.

confidential, yahof-hahig: The finance team signed off on a budget of $169.6 million for Project Julox.